The question

What is the adopted view regarding yellowish and brownish discharges during the period of purity: Are they impure and invalidate ablution, or pure and invalidate it, or pure and do not invalidate it, given the disagreement among muftis and the questioner's trust in their knowledge and piety?

The answer

Yellow and brownish discharges are impure (najis) and invalidate ablution (wudu'). They are not like "vaginal discharges." No recognized jurist (faqih) has ever deemed them pure, except for Ibn Hazm, who held that they do not invalidate ablution, but this opinion is considered anachronistic (shadh).
